Services and pricing

Picture Perfect charges $150 to $180 per visit for a standard three-bedroom, two-bathroom home on a recurring schedule (weekly, bi-weekly, or monthly). Larger homes or additional services shift the price upward. One-time deep cleans run $250 to $350 for the same three-bed, two-bath footprint, reflecting the labor intensity of baseboards, inside appliances, and window washing. Move-out cleaning, typically required by landlords or when selling, costs $300 to $450 depending on home condition and size.

Most recurring customers choose bi-weekly service, which balances cost and home maintenance. Weekly service ($600 to $720 monthly for a mid-size home) suits households with pets, young children, or people with mobility concerns. Monthly service ($150 to $180) works for smaller households or those with minimal foot traffic. Pricing varies by square footage and clutter level; confirm the exact quote for your home before committing.

How Picture Perfect compares to other Oklahoma City options

Oklahoma City has two broad cleaning models: national franchises like Maid Pro and Angie's List-connected independents. Maid Pro typically charges $25 to $30 per person-hour with a two-to-three-hour minimum per visit, which can run $50 to $90 for a quick maintenance clean or $150 to $200 for deeper work on a three-bedroom home. Maid Pro's advantage is consistency (same crew, strict protocols) and broader availability; its drawback is less flexibility on scheduling and often a one-month minimum commitment.

Picture Perfect's advantage is neighborhood familiarity and direct communication without a franchise middleman. If your bathroom needs special attention or you want to skip the guest bedroom one week, you negotiate directly with the owner rather than through a corporate system. The trade-off is that availability depends on crew size; during summer, booking gaps can open up faster than at a larger operation.

For one-time deep cleans, local handyman networks and independent cleaners often underbid at $200 to $280, but inconsistent quality and lack of bonding are common complaints. Picture Perfect's bonding covers damage or theft, a safety net worth the modest premium.

Choose Picture Perfect if you value a local relationship and flexible scheduling. Choose Maid Pro if you prioritize consistency and don't mind a structured contract. Choose an unaffiliated independent only if you have a personal referral and have verified their insurance.

What the first visit involves

The first visit typically starts with a walkthrough where the owner or lead cleaner assesses room count, layout, and any special requests or areas to avoid. This takes 20 to 30 minutes. The cleaner will ask about pet-safe products, preferred storage locations for supplies, and which surfaces are off-limits. You provide house keys or keypad access. Cleaning on the first visit usually takes 3 to 4 hours for a three-bedroom home. Payment is due at the end of the first visit or by invoice; recurring customers set up a preferred payment method (card, check, or digital transfer) for future visits.
